Asp.net Registration Form with SQL Database Validation Part – 2

첫 번째 비디오에서 우리는 등록 양식 디자인을 만들고 이제 우리는 데이터베이스를 우리 양식에 연결합니다 데이터베이스 연결이 끊어져서 파일을 만들 수 없다면 수동으로 파일을 추가하십시오

여기에서 데이터베이스 파일을 추가 할 수 있습니다 또는이 파일을 앱 데이터 폴더를 클릭하여 추가하고 SQL Server 데이터베이스 파일을 추가 할 수 있습니다 Databasemdf 파일을 두 번 클릭하여 테이블 만들기를 엽니 다 테이블을 마우스 오른쪽 버튼으로 클릭하고 새 쿼리를 선택하십시오

그래픽으로 표를 생성 할 수 있습니다 테이블이 성공적으로 생성 된 것을 볼 수 있습니다 본문의 맨 아래에 SQLDataSource를 추가하십시오 데이터베이스 파일을 선택하십시오 이 연결 문자열을 사용하여 데이터베이스에 연결할 수도 있습니다

하지만이 구성 연결 문자열을 사용하여 데이터베이스에 연결하고 있습니다 Query를 클릭하여 연결을 확인하십시오 이제 Button to Submit 데이터에서 onlick 이벤트를 만듭니다 globle 네임 스페이스 파일을 추가하여 SQL 데이터베이스 명령을 사용하십시오 새 SQl 연결을 만듭니다

문자열에 sql 명령을 저장합니다 이름이 맞는지 확인하십시오 그렇지 않으면 오류 메시지가 나타납니다 새 SQL 명령을 만듭니다 새 SQL 명령에 sql 명령 문자열을 전달하십시오

또한 연결 고리를 통과시킵니다 값 매개 변수 이름을 추가하십시오 값 매개 변수의 이름이 올바른지 확인하십시오 값을 테이블에 삽입하려는 텍스트 상자 이름을 추가하십시오 ExecuteNonQuery를 사용하여 삽입, 업데이트 및 삭제 명령을 실행합니다

마지막으로 데이터베이스 연결을 종료합니다 성공적으로 등록되었음을 나타내는 레이블을 추가하십시오 이제 Textbox에 대한 유효성 검사 컨트롤을 추가하고 있습니다 첫 번째 텍스트 상자 유효성 검사는 필수 입력란 유효성 검사입니다 이 유효성 검사를 추가하면 빈 텍스트 상자를 남길 수 없습니다

정규 표현식 검사기는 사용자 입력의 유효성을 검사하는 데 사용됩니다 이 확인을 통해 비밀번호가 3 ~ 10 자 사이인지 확인합니다 Compare Validator는 입력 값을 다른 입력 컨트롤과 비교하는 데 사용됩니다 파트 -1의 링크가 설명에 있습니다 당신은 오류 마사지를 볼 수 있습니다

질문이 있으시면 비디오 댓글 섹션에서 저에게 질문하십시오 설명에서이 프로젝트를 다운로드 할 수 있습니다